AAUW Rancho Bernardo Interest Groups
Interest Groups offer AAUW members a chance to do what they enjoy and to explore new areas of interest. All members are encouraged to participate in a variety of Interest Groups as a means of getting to know in greater depth those fellow members with similar interests.
Each group is autonomous and self-supporting, choosing its own leadership and setting its own program and schedule. Most groups meet in members’ homes and some offer carpooling.
Membership in the Rancho Bernardo Branch is required for participation in our Interest Groups

Afternoon Readers
Group members select the books to be read. Everyone reads the same book for discussion at the monthly meeting with one member facilitating the discussion. |
|
|
Cinema
Emphasis is on the type of quality films that are shown at the Landmark Theaters in Hillcrest and La Jolla Village. Each month the group selects the movies to be seen that month. Reactions to these films are shared the following month. Carpooling is arranged for one matinee. |
Creative Writing
This group will meet once monthly to share writing efforts. The chairperson will provide prompts and handouts to inspire writing of the personal narrative and poetry. |
Mah Jongg
Mah Jongg is played every Wednesday morning from 9:30 to 12:30 with each participating member taking her turn as hostess. Call one of the chairs for more information. |
Mystery Book Group
All group members suggest mysteries to be read. Everyone reads the same mystery for our monthly discussion. Facilitating and hostessing is on a rotating basis. |
Walking
Every Monday and Thursday participants meet near the Oaks North Community Center. The route and length of the walk varies. Additional starting points could be arranged if requested. |
Women’s Bridge
Every 4 to 5 months participants are divided into groups of 4. Each foursome plays 4 times within the following 4 months. Times and days are arranged by the individual foursome. Substitutes are also needed. |
